What is an overnight Informix DBA?

Overnight Informix DBAs are database administrators who specialize in managing and maintaining IBM Informix databases during overnight shifts. Their primary responsibilities include monitoring database performance, performing backups, addressing issues that arise after regular business hours, and ensuring that databases remain available and secure. These professionals are essential for organizations that require 24/7 database uptime and quick responses to incidents or maintenance needs that occur overnight.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an overnight Informix DBA?

To thrive as an Overnight Informix DBA, you need expertise in Informix database administration, SQL scripting, and system troubleshooting, often backed by a degree in computer science or related certifications. Familiarity with Informix tools, monitoring utilities, backup/recovery software, and ticketing systems is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for managing critical incidents during off-hours. These abilities are essential to ensure database reliability, rapid issue resolution, and continuous system availability in 24/7 operational environments.

How does an overnight Informix DBA typically collaborate with other IT teams during off-hours?

As an Overnight Informix DBA, you’ll often coordinate with network engineers, application support teams, and on-call managers to address urgent issues that arise after regular business hours. Communication is usually handled through ticketing systems, emails, and scheduled check-ins to ensure that any incidents are tracked and resolved efficiently. While you may work independently most of the shift, you’ll also be responsible for providing detailed handover reports to the day team, ensuring seamless continuity of database operations. This collaborative approach helps maintain database health and minimizes downtime for critical business systems.

Job Description



Position: SQL Server DBA 

Duration: 1 Year 

Location: TX-500 W Dove Rd-Southlake (TX0549)

Direct Client: Immediate interview 

Job Responsibilities 


Planning, building, implementing, administering, and maintaining SQL SERVER databases in the Commercial Data Systems (CDS) organization. Builds and successfully integrates complex, multi-Terabyte OLTP databases with minimal supervision. Ensures optimal database performance through exhaustive pre-service testing and ongoing real-time monitoring. Troubleshoots issues to resolution. 

Maintains database security and enterprise policy guidelines according to best practices. Recommends new and improved guidelines to ensure high availability and stability 

Works directly with internal customers to plan, evaluate, and design network databases in accordance with team and company standards. Conducts benchmark tests to gauge hardware capacity and meet application capacity requirements. Documents business and technical requirements. Creates technically viable, cost-effective system designs and develops customer-focused implementation strategies. Mentors other DBAs in the group. 

Provides tasks and timelines to support the creation of project plans with appropriate updates for those tasks throughout the project lifecycle. 

Performs On-Call duties as assigned on a rotational basis. Occasional overnight travel to other company work locations as required. 


Qualifications 

Minimum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ering or other related degree, relevant military experience. 

Sql Server DBA with 5+ years of SQL Expertise in SQLServer release 2008. At least 5 years of sql server DBA experience in an enterprise environment supporting all aspects of a sql server Database Server with emphasis on 2-tiered and 3-tiered architecture. 

Experience in newer SQL Server releases/high availability solutions and release upgrades is strongly desired. 

Strong experience in monitoring and tuning sql server databases for optimum performance and assistance in capacity planning of sql server database servers. Deep knowledge about Relational Database design and analysis; extremely proficient in SQL.
